    Szstemic help to families with a developmentally challenged child mainly00000ne hand, focuses on the problems of the child. Our qualitative research has provided some insight into the factors that ... determine the system mother-developmentally challenged child-family-environment. Structured interviews have been carried out with twelve mothers of developmentally challenged children. The data confirmed that it is mothers who take over the greatest part of care. In general, they steer between, on the one hand, feelings of guild and helplessness and fears, which are often reinforced by negative prognoses and information given by professionals, and on the other hand, their love for the child and the fight for the better future. In their efforts that their child should maximally develop his or her potentials they again meet what is called 'over-optimism and unreal expectations'. A great majority of interviewed mothers find that the 'misfortune' has changed their lives and has given them unexpected opportunities for personal growth.
